Pinnacle Group are seeking a dedicated Cleaner to maintain high standards of cleanliness and hygiene in our communities. You will be joining our Cleaning Team who are based at a large housing site in Hinkley.

Our Soft Facilities Management division delivers essential services to homes, schools, universities and public sector organisations – including housing providers and blue light authorities. We focus on creating clean, safe and welcoming environments, with a commitment to quality, community impact and customer care..

Your role will involve general cleaning duties such as sweeping, mopping, dusting, and waste management to ensure a welcoming environment for all residents.

You will be reliable, detail-oriented, and committed to delivering excellence. If you take pride in your work and have a passion for creating clean, safe spaces, we encourage you to apply

The hours are 8am to 10.30am, Monday to Friday, 12.5 hours per week.

Key Responsibilities Will Include

Cleaning of communal internal and external areas such as lifts, stairs, courtyards, paths, grass etc. as per required contract specification. Removing any dumped refuse bags and household items to refuse chambers or other refuse areas. Checking communal lighting and replacing blown bulbs. Sweeping of hard surfaces and litter picking of soft surfaces. Cleaning windows within easy reach.

Key Requirements

Cleaning experience in a professional setting. Experience using cleaning machinery. Strong communication skills in order to speak with the residents.
